Subject: [PATCH 3/4] VMX: unifdef the EFER specific code

To allow access to the EFER register in 32bit KVM the EFER specific code has to
be exported to the x86 generic code. This patch does this in a backwards
compatible manner.

 ar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c |    8 --------
 1 files changed, 0 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c b/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c
index f66283a..8496dbe 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c
@@ -1336,8 +1336,6 @@ static void vmx_set_cr4(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, unsigned long cr4)
 	vcpu->arch.cr4 = cr4;
 }
 
-#ifdef CONFIG_X86_64
-
 static void vmx_set_efer(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, u64 efer)
 {
 	struct vcpu_vmx *vmx = to_vmx(vcpu);
@@ -1360,8 +1358,6 @@ static void vmx_set_efer(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, u64 efer)
 	setup_msrs(vmx);
 }
 
-#endif
-
 static u64 vmx_get_segment_base(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, int seg)
 {
 	struct kvm_vmx_segment_field *sf = &kvm_vmx_segment_fields[seg];
@@ -1776,9 +1772,7 @@ static int vmx_vcpu_reset(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 	vmx->vcpu.arch.cr0 = 0x60000010;
 	vmx_set_cr0(&vmx->vcpu, vmx->vcpu.arch.cr0); /* enter rmode */
 	vmx_set_cr4(&vmx->vcpu, 0);
-#ifdef CONFIG_X86_64
 	vmx_set_efer(&vmx->vcpu, 0);
-#endif
 	vmx_fpu_activate(&vmx->vcpu);
 	update_exception_bitmap(&vmx->vcpu);
 
@@ -2666,9 +2660,7 @@ static struct kvm_x86_ops vmx_x86_ops = {
 	.set_cr0 = vmx_set_cr0,
 	.set_cr3 = vmx_set_cr3,
 	.set_cr4 = vmx_set_cr4,
-#ifdef CONFIG_X86_64
 	.set_efer = vmx_set_efer,
-#endif
 	.get_idt = vmx_get_idt,
 	.set_idt = vmx_set_idt,
 	.get_gdt = vmx_get_gdt,
